Why Choose the 2 Day Inca Trail Over Other Options?
A Scenic, Efficient Alternative to the Classic Trek
The 2 Day Inca Trail covers about 10-12 kilometers of stunning Andean scenery, cloud forests, and archaeological sites. Unlike the 4-day trek, this route starts near Cusco and lets you visit Wiñay Wayna and arrive at Machu Picchu through the Sun Gate in just two days. This makes it a perfect choice for those seeking a blend of adventure and efficiency on the Inca Trail Cusco to Machu Picchu.

What Makes the 2 Day Inca Trail Special?
Preserved History in a Short Distance
Though shorter in length, the 2 Day Inca Trail includes some of the most significant Incan ruins. You'll pass ancient sites like Chachabamba and Wiñay Wayna, with expert insight from our bilingual guides at Luan Travel Peru. This journey is not just a hike—it's a story told step by step.
Arrive at Machu Picchu Like the Incas Did
On Day 2, you'll enter Machu Picchu through the Inti Punku (Sun Gate), just as the Incas once did. The view is breathtaking and unmatched by any bus ride or train route. This is why so many travelers in 2025 are choosing the 2 Day Inca Trail as their preferred route.

2. Do I need a guide for the 2 Day Inca Trail?
Yes. Guided treks are mandatory to preserve the trail and ensure safety. Luan Travel Peru offers licensed guides with deep local knowledge and fluency in English and Spanish.

5. When is the best time to hike the 2 Day Inca Trail in 2025?
The dry season, from May to September, offers the best weather. Early booking with Luan Travel Peru is essential due to high demand.
